12 Stylish Layering Outfits for Cold Weather

Layering outfits during cold weather is not just practical; it can also be incredibly stylish when done right. When temperatures drop, finding the balance between warmth and looking chic is key.

From cozy knits and tailored coats to trendy puffer jackets and oversized scarves, layering gives you the flexibility to adjust your outfit to the weather.

Here are 12 stylish layering outfit ideas to help you stay warm and fashionable throughout the chilly season.

1. Classic Turtleneck and Blazer Combo

A turtleneck paired with a blazer is a timeless layering look that keeps you warm while looking polished. Opt for a fitted turtleneck in a neutral color like black or beige, which can go with almost any blazer.

Add a thick wool blazer for extra warmth and style, and finish off the look with straight-leg jeans or tailored trousers. This outfit is perfect for days when you want a smart-casual vibe that can take you from work to evening outings effortlessly.

2. Oversized Sweater with Long Coat

An oversized sweater layered under a long coat is cozy and comfortable without sacrificing style. Choose a chunky knit sweater in a seasonal color, such as deep green or burgundy, and wear it with a classic wool coat that hits below the knee.

This pairing is ideal for layering because you can add a thermal shirt or light sweater underneath the oversized sweater for extra warmth. Complete the look with skinny jeans and ankle boots to balance the silhouette.

3. Button-Down Shirt and Sweater Vest

For a preppy yet cozy layered look, a button-down shirt topped with a sweater vest is a great choice. Go for a classic white or light blue button-down shirt, and layer a warm sweater vest in a contrasting color or pattern, such as plaid or argyle.

This outfit is versatile and can be dressed up or down, depending on whether you pair it with jeans or a skirt. It’s a great option for days when you need something cozy yet professional.

4. Thermal Layer with Puffer Jacket

When the temperature really drops, a thermal layer is essential. Start with a thermal long-sleeve top, followed by a hoodie or thick sweater. Layer a puffer jacket over the top for ultimate warmth.

This combination works well with joggers or fleece-lined leggings for a comfortable yet fashionable look. Choose a puffer jacket in a bright color or metallic sheen to add a pop of style to this ultra-warm ensemble.

5. Flannel Shirt, Cardigan, and Leather Jacket

A flannel shirt paired with a cardigan and topped with a leather jacket is both trendy and practical. This look gives you layers that can be adjusted depending on the indoor or outdoor temperature. Choose a plaid flannel shirt, a neutral-toned cardigan, and a sleek black or brown leather jacket. The combination of textures adds visual interest, while the layers keep you cozy. Pair it with skinny jeans and combat boots to complete the look.

6. Hoodie with Trench Coat

For a modern, urban look, layer a hoodie under a trench coat. The hoodie provides warmth and comfort, while the trench coat adds a layer of sophistication. Opt for a neutral-toned hoodie and a classic beige or black trench coat.

This pairing works well with jeans, joggers, or leggings, making it versatile enough for errands or casual outings. Finish off with sneakers or ankle boots to keep the look relaxed and chic.

7. Dress with Turtleneck and Tights

If you love wearing dresses year-round, a turtleneck under a dress is an ideal layering solution. Choose a warm, knit turtleneck and layer it under a sleeveless or short-sleeve dress for a cozy yet feminine look.

Tights or thermal leggings will add an extra layer of warmth. This outfit is perfect for days when you want a softer, more romantic style without sacrificing comfort.

8. Base Layer, Shirt, and Denim Jacket

A base layer, such as a thermal or fitted long-sleeve shirt, paired with a button-down shirt and topped with a denim jacket is a classic, casual layering option.

Choose a flannel or corduroy shirt for added warmth and a relaxed vibe, and finish off with a cozy denim jacket. This combination is comfortable and versatile, perfect for days when you need warmth without a heavy coat. Wear it with high-waisted jeans and ankle boots to keep it laid-back.

9. Turtleneck with Sleeveless Puffer Vest

For milder winter days, a turtleneck and puffer vest combo provides warmth without feeling too heavy. Start with a fitted or oversized turtleneck and add a sleeveless puffer vest in a complementary color.

This look is great for layering because it lets you move freely while keeping your core warm. Pair it with jeans or fleece-lined leggings and boots for a look that’s ready for outdoor adventures or casual outings.

10. Long-Sleeve Top, Sweater, and Peacoat

This classic layered look combines warmth with timeless style. Start with a fitted long-sleeve top, add a cozy sweater, and finish off with a peacoat. Choose a color palette of neutral tones or go for a pop of color in the sweater for added style.

This outfit works well with slim-fit jeans or tailored pants, and can be dressed up with heeled boots or kept casual with flat boots. It’s a sophisticated look that’s suitable for both work and weekend plans.

11. Thermal Leggings with Skirt and Long Coat

For a unique winter look, try layering thermal leggings with a skirt and a long coat. This combination lets you wear skirts in cold weather without sacrificing warmth.

Start with fleece-lined leggings or thick tights, and add a wool or tweed skirt for texture. Top with a long wool coat that complements the colors in your outfit. Pair this with ankle boots or knee-high boots for a stylish finish.

12. Sweatshirt, Puffer Coat, and Scarf

A sweatshirt and puffer coat is an unbeatable combination for warmth, and adding a scarf brings extra coziness and style. Start with a fitted or oversized sweatshirt, and layer a puffer coat on top.

Finish with a chunky scarf in a contrasting color for visual interest. This look works great with jeans or joggers and is perfect for days when you’ll be spending a lot of time outdoors.


Tips for Layering Like a Pro

  1. Use Base Layers Wisely: A base layer like thermals or fitted long sleeves is essential in cold weather. Choose moisture-wicking materials to keep you warm and dry.
  2. Play with Textures: Mixing textures like wool, leather, and flannel can add depth to your outfit and make each layer stand out.
  3. Balance Your Silhouette: If you’re wearing oversized items on top, keep the bottom half fitted, and vice versa. This creates a balanced look that doesn’t appear bulky.
  4. Accessorize with Functionality in Mind: Scarves, hats, and gloves add extra warmth and can be a style statement. Choose high-quality materials like wool or cashmere for both warmth and a polished look.
  5. Stick to a Color Scheme: Choosing a color palette for your layers makes it easier to mix and match pieces. Neutrals like black, gray, and beige are versatile, but a pop of color can brighten up a winter look.
